怎么装置mysql数据库,具体进程攻略
装置MySQL数据库是一个相对简略的进程,但具体的进程或许会因操作体系和MySQL版别的不同而有所差异。以下是一个通用的攻略,适用于大多数Linux发行版。假如你运用的是Windows或MacOS,装置进程或许会有所不同。
在Linux上装置MySQL
1. 更新软件包列表: 在装置MySQL之前,保证你的体系是最新的。你能够运用以下指令来更新软件包列表:
```bash sudo apt update ```
这儿的指令适用于依据Debian的体系,如Ubuntu。假如你运用的是其他发行版,如RedHat或CentOS,你或许需求运用`yum`或`dnf`来更新软件包列表。
2. 装置MySQL: 你能够运用以下指令来装置MySQL:
```bash sudo apt install mysqlserver ```
在装置进程中,体系或许会提示你设置root用户的暗码。请保证记住这个暗码,由于它是办理MySQL数据库的超级用户。
3. 发动MySQL服务: 装置完结后,你能够运用以下指令来发动MySQL服务:
```bash sudo systemctl start mysql ```
保证MySQL服务在发动后现已设置为开机自启:
```bash sudo systemctl enable mysql ```
4. 安全装备MySQL: 为了进步安全性,主张你运转`mysql_secure_installation`脚本。这个脚本会协助你设置一些安全选项,比方移除匿名用户、制止root用户长途登录、删去测验数据库等。
```bash sudo mysql_secure_installation ```
5. 登录MySQL: 装置和装备完结后,你能够运用以下指令来登录MySQL:
```bash mysql u root p ```
这儿的`u`选项指定了用户名(root),`p`选项表明需求输入暗码。输入暗码后,你就能够开端运用MySQL了。
在Windows上装置MySQL
1. 下载MySQL装置包: 你能够从MySQL的官方网站下载适用于Windows的装置包。保证下载的是最新版别,而且适宜你的体系(32位或64位)。
2. 运转装置导游: 双击下载的装置包,然后依照装置导游的提示进行操作。在装置进程中,你或许会被要求挑选装置类型(如Developer Default、Server only等)。
3. 装备MySQL服务: 在装置进程中,你或许需求装备MySQL服务。这包含设置root用户的暗码、挑选字符集和排序规矩等。
4. 发动MySQL服务: 装置完结后,你能够经过服务办理器或指令提示符来发动MySQL服务。
5. 连接到MySQL: 你能够运用MySQL指令行东西或图形界面东西(如MySQL Workbench)来连接到MySQL数据库。
在MacOS上装置MySQL
1. 运用Homebrew装置: 假如你的MacOS上现已装置了Homebrew,你能够运用以下指令来装置MySQL:
```bash brew install mysql ```
2. 运用包办理器装置: 你也能够从MySQL的官方网站下载适用于MacOS的装置包,然后依照装置导游的提示进行操作。
3. 发动MySQL服务: 装置完结后,你能够运用以下指令来发动MySQL服务:
```bash mysql.server start ```
4. 连接到MySQL: 你能够运用MySQL指令行东西或图形界面东西(如MySQL Workbench)来连接到MySQL数据库。
注意事项
保证你的体系满意MySQL的最低要求。 在装置进程中,请依据提示进行相应的装备。 装置完结后,主张运转安全装备脚原本进步安全性。 定时更新MySQL和操作体系,以保证体系的安全性。
怎么装置MySQL数据库:具体进程攻略

MySQL是一个广泛运用的开源联系型数据库办理体系(RDBMS),以其高效、安稳和易用性而遭到全球开发者的喜欢。本文将具体介绍怎么在多种操作体系上装置MySQL数据库,并供给具体的进程攻略。
一、挑选适宜的MySQL版别

在开端装置之前,首要需求挑选适宜的MySQL版别。MySQL主要有两个版别:社区版和企业版。社区版免费,适宜中小型企业和个人开发者;企业版则供给更多的高档功用和技术支持,适宜大型企业运用。
社区版:开源,功用丰厚,适宜大多数开发和测验环境。
企业版:供给高档功用,如更高的安全性、功用优化、备份和康复功用等。
二、下载MySQL装置包

拜访MySQL官方网站(https://www.mysql.com/)。
挑选与您的操作体系匹配的装置包格局,如RPM、DEB、TAR等。
下载完结后,运用SHA256或MD5校验码验证装置包的完整性。
三、Windows上的MySQL装置
以下是Windows操作体系上装置MySQL的进程:
双击下载的装置包,依照导游指示进行装置。
在装备进程中,挑选服务器类型(如开发计算机、多用户服务器等),设置数据存储方位,以及装备网络选项。
设置root账户暗码:装置进程中会提示设置MySQL root用户的初始暗码,必须记住。
完结装置后,点击“Finish”完毕装置。
四、Linux上的MySQL装置
以下是Linux操作体系上装置MySQL的进程:
更新体系软件源:运用sudo apt-get update或yum update指令更新您的体系软件源。
装置MySQL:在Ubuntu/Debian上运用sudo apt-get install mysql-server,在CentOS/RHEL上运用sudo yum install mysql-server。
初始化MySQL:装置完结后,运转sudo mysql_secure_installation设置root暗码和其他安全选项。
发动MySQL服务:运用sudo systemctl start mysql发动服务,并用sudo systemctl enable mysql设置开机发动。
五、MacOS上的MySQL装置
以下是MacOS操作体系上装置MySQL的进程:
运用Homebrew进行装置:在终端中履行以下指令:brew install mysql。
装置完结后,MySQL服务一般会主动发动。
运用以下指令查看MySQL服务状况:sudo systemctl status mysql。
设置root暗码:初次装置MySQL时,root用户默许没有暗码。为了进步安全性,您需求设置root用户的暗码。在终端中履行以下指令:sudo mysql_secure_installation,依照提示进行设置。
六、装备MySQL
修正装备文件:MySQL的装备文件一般坐落/etc/my.cnf或/etc/mysql/my.cnf。您能够依据需求修正参数,如最大连接数、字符集等。
设置字符集:为了保证数据的一致性,主张将字符集设置为UTF-8。
经过以上进程,您能够在Windows、Linux和MacOS操作体系上成功装置和装备MySQL数据库。在装置进程中,请保证遵从官方文档的辅导,以保证数据库的安全性和安稳性。
- 上一篇:大数据的了解,什么是大数据?
- 下一篇:数据库字典表,了解其重要性与运用
猜你喜欢
数据库
mysql数据库怎样创立表,什么是MySQL数据库表?
在MySQL数据库中创立表是一个相对简略的进程,您能够运用SQL(结构化查询言语)句子来完结。以下是创立表的进程:1.连接到MySQL服务器:在运用MySQL指令行东西(如mysql)时,您需求先登录到MySQL服务器。运用以下指令:...
2025-02-25 1数据库
与大数据同行,大数据年代,咱们怎么与数据同行
1.工作挑选:在当今数据驱动的国际中,越来越多的人挑选从事与大数据相关的工作。这包含数据剖析师、数据科学家、数据工程师等职位。这些专业人士担任搜集、处理、剖析和解说很多数据,以协助企业做出更好的决议计划。2.技能进步:跟着大数据技能的不...
2025-02-25 1数据库
更改数据库称号, MySQL数据库更改数据库称号的进程
更改数据库称号是一个相对简略的操作,但具体进程取决于你运用的数据库办理体系(DBMS)。下面是一些常见DBMS的更改数据库称号的进程:1.MySQL:首要,登录到MySQL服务器。运用`RENAMEDATABASE`句子...
2025-02-25 1数据库
数据库表结构,数据库表结构规划的重要性
为了供给数据库表结构的详细信息,我需求知道以下几点:1.数据库类型:例如,是联系型数据库(如MySQL、PostgreSQL)仍是NoSQL数据库(如MongoDB、Cassandra)。2.表称号:需求知道详细的表名,以便供给...
2025-02-25 1数据库
大数据对互联网,互联网的革新之路
1.用户行为剖析:大数据能够协助互联网公司了解用户的行为形式、偏好和需求。经过剖析用户在网站上的阅读记载、查找前史、购买行为等数据,公司能够更好地了解用户,供给个性化的引荐和服务。2.个性化引荐:依据大数据剖析,互联网公司能够为用户供给...
2025-02-25 1数据库
数据库分库分表计划, 数据库分库分表原理
数据库分库分表计划是一种常见的数据库扩展和优化战略,首要用于处理数据库的并发拜访、数据量添加、功能瓶颈等问题。以下是分库分表计划的一些基本概念和施行进程:1.分库分表的基本概念分库:将一个数据库拆分红多个数据库,每个数据库包括不同的数...
2025-02-25 2数据库
大数据机房,构建高效数据处理的柱石
1.基础设备:大数据机房一般装备高功用的核算机硬件,包含服务器、存储设备、网络设备等。这些设备需求可以处理很多的数据,而且具有较高的安稳性和可靠性。2.数据存储:大数据机房需求很多的存储空间来存储数据。这些存储设备可所以传统的硬盘驱动器...
2025-02-25 1数据库
大数据展望,未来趋势与应战
大数据是指规划巨大、类型多样、发生速度快且价值密度低的数据调集。跟着信息技能的飞速开展,大数据已经成为推进社会进步和经济开展的重要力气。未来,大数据的开展将出现以下几个趋势:1.数据量持续增长:跟着物联网、人工智能、云核算等技能的遍及,数...
2025-02-25 1